Everything in Khloe with a K's life changed when she crashed into the side of a food truck. Now with Earth in the rearview mirror, her future lies with Briggs, Goran, Reese, and Dalton. Forging their bonds was only the first step, but will it be enough to sustain them in the face of new challenges?*Please note, this is a reverse harem and the authors suggest you always read the forwards in their books. This is the third in a trilogy.

I love books. Not just a little bit, but a lot. Books were my best friends when I was growing up. Books didn’t care if I was new to a town or to a class. They were always there, my trustiest of companions. Until they turned on me and said I had to write them.

I can tell you that my own personal happily ever after included writing books. I’ve always said that an HEA is a work in progress. It’s true in my marriage, my friendships, and in my career. I am constantly nurturing my muse as we dive into new tales, new tropes, new characters and more.

After seventeen years back in Texas, we relocated to the Pacific Northwest in search of seasons, new experiences, and new geography. I can’t wait to discover what life (and my muse) have in store for me.

Maybe writing was always my destiny and romance my fate. After all, my grandmother wasn’t a fan of picture books and used to read me her Harlequin Romance novels.

Friends to lovers, enemies to lovers, friends to enemies to lovers, you name it, I love them and love to write them. I started with Earth Witches Aren’t Easy, the first in the Chance Monroe trilogy, but my characters and I have traveled a long way since I created that urban fantasy world.

One of the series I hear my readers recommend the most is the Untouchable series followed in quick succession by the Vandals, and that just delights me. No lie, whenever one of my readers brings up my wolves, I do a little a fist pump.

A galaxy spanning sexy, funny and delightful Reverse Harem space opera comes to an exciting and happy ending.

This is a reverse harem space opera is Catherine Asaro or Andre Norton wrote RHSO! Filled with space ships, queens and dastardly warmongering villains who will be thwarted by all the queen's men. And even more wonderfully, the greatest space opera of all time pops it's Lucasfilm head up in dialogue, which filled me with an appropriate amount of sci-fi nerd glee.

The world building was splendid and the underlying political message added to the depth. The image of the poorer portions of the city being in the literal dark, forced to return to lighting their homes with “torches” - flashlights, it is explained, but the image still remains of a space faring empire that can't provide even the basic lighting for its poor in heart-wrenching.

The characters, at least our 4 main men and our brilliant heroine don't see a tremendous growth arc, just a few issues from the earlier books finally get worked out. I I love that the strong, powerful queen – Khloe with a K - is wise enough to let her men – her advisors – tell her what needs to be done in an unfamiliar situation and doesn't fight it for the sake of fighting. Her solution to the growing tension on her planet and the possibility of a coup was brilliant and encompassed the whole “Home is not a place but a feeling” theme.

The writing is beautiful, filled with gorgeous, intricate imagery of both space and people's souls. That alone is worth the read.

All in all, an impressive, delicious end to a potent, fantastic Space Opera Reverse Harem

I'm a freshman to Reverse Harem. I don't know if I will graduate to sophomore. There are some things that I love about Reverse Harem, and somethings I don't. I digress; Heart of the Nebula was a different Reverse Harem than most I have read; it wasn't as intense. It was sweet, gentle, and at times I thought it was kind of corny. Oh, let me go back and explain that this review is for all 3 books in the series.

Queenmaker started out good, and then it kind of lagged, and then it picked back up. I love Khloe and the guys. My only complaint was I thought the authors were a bit over the top with the pet names the guys had for Khloe. My rating for it is a 4.

For some odd reason I wasn't that invested in Deal Breaker. Yes, there was some interesting surprises in it, and you got to see Khloe and the guys bond strength, but those pet names drove me crazy. Sometimes I thought the authors used sex as a filler. My rating for it is a 3

Throne Taker was about the same as Queenmaker. I liked seeing Khloe grow in her role as queen. It was exciting to read about all the espionage, and learn things about her home planet. I wish the authors would have spent more time on world building. There was more I wanted to learn about the guys and their past, and how they survived on the planet without Khloe. I had questions that never got answered; therefore my rating is a 4.

I wish the authors would have taken the time to extend the series. I felt there was more that needed to be said and more I wanted to learn about these characters. Also, the way the series ended left room for them to possibly expand on this series.
